前言
本文件按照GB/T1.1—2020《标准化工作导则第1部分:标准化文件的结构和起草规则》的规
定起草。
本文件代替GB/T25763—2010《滚动轴承汽车变速箱用滚针轴承》,与GB/T25763—2010相
比,除结构调整和编辑性改动外,主要技术变化如下:
a)更改了适用范围(见第1章,2010年版的第1章);
b)增加了推力滚针轴承组件等部分滚针轴承分类(见第5章);
c)增加了推力滚针轴承组件等部分轴承的代号方法和代号示例(见6.2.3、6.4);
d)增加了推力滚针轴承组件等部分轴承的结构型式(见7.6);
e)增加了“外形尺寸”一章(见第8章);
f)更改了冲压外圈滚针轴承外径公差的尺寸范围(见表8,2010年版的表7);
g)增加了推力滚针轴承组件的公差(见表9、表10);
h)更改了清洁度控制指标及测试滤膜孔径尺寸(见9.7、10.6,2010年版的8.7、9.6)。
请注意本文件的某些内容可能涉及专利。本文件的发布机构不承担识别专利的责任。
本文件由中国机械工业联合会提出。
本文件由全国滚动轴承标准化技术委员会(SAC/TC98)归口。
本文件起草单位:常州光洋轴承股份有限公司、洛阳轴承研究所有限公司、镇江飞亚轴承有限责任
公司、襄阳汽车轴承股份有限公司、上海人本集团有限公司。
本文件主要起草人:王子铭、王星星、李飞雪、宋晓梅、郭平、郭长建、汤伟庆。
本文件于2010年首次发布,本次为第一次修订。

滚动轴承汽车变速箱用滚针轴承
1范围
本文件规定了汽车变速箱用滚针轴承的代号方法、结构类型、外形尺寸、技术要求、检测方法、检验
规则、标志和防锈包装。
本文件适用于汽车变速箱用滚针轴承(以下简称“轴承”)的制造。
